I have been a smoker for almost 10 yrs. I have two ulcers in my mouth, one on each side of my tongue. One is painful almost all of the time. The other is occasionally painful. I've seen two doctors, a dentist (for another reason, and he wasn't concerned with the ulcer at all), and a pathologist. After scraping the ulcers, the pathologist assured me it wasn't cancer. To make a long story short, I've had the ulcers for a year now. I have no insurance to help with any bills, and don't know what to do. I have recently had a terrible sinus infection, and the lymph node under my arm is swollen and painful. It's been that way for a couple of weeks, and I'm scared to death that it is swollen because of cancer, and not just the infection. If anyone has had similar symptoms or has any advice, please contact me. Thank you!

Nicki,

Please make an appointment with an oral surgeon and/or oral maxiofacial surgeon, or even a general surgeon and get a bio done. This is essential to catch oral cancer in the early stages. If you don't have insurance, explain that to them. Most will make arrangements for payments. Please just don't wait and longer, the sooner cancer is caught the better your chance of survival. Please keep us posted.

I agree. A biopsy now is not expensive and really needs to be done if you have had something like this that has not gotten better over the course of a year. Please get it checked. The earlier the diagnosis of something bad, the better the final outcome.
